Tropical Mango Salad with Cucumber and Lime Dressing Recipe

Ingredients

Scale

Main Ingredients

  • 2 ripe mangoes, peeled and cubed
  • 1 cucumber, diced
  • 1/4 red onion, thinly sliced
  • 1/4 cup fresh cilantro, chopped

Dressing

  • 1 tablespoon lime juice
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on honey (or maple syrup for vegan)
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per

Optional

  • 1/2 jalapeño, finely chopped (optional, for heat)

Instructions

  1. Combine Ingredients: In a large bowl, add the cubed mango, diced cucumber, thinly sliced red onion, and chopped fresh cilantro. Gently toss the ingredients to mix them evenly.
  2. Prepare Dressing: In a small bowl, whisk together the lime juice, olive oil, honey (or maple syrup), salt, and black pepper until fully combined to create a tangy and slightly sweet dressing.
  3. Toss Salad: Pour the dressing over the mango and cucumber mixture. Gently toss all the ingredients until the salad is evenly coated with the dressing, ensuring each bite is flavorful.
  4. Add Heat (Optional): If desired, incorporate the finely chopped jalapeño to add a subtle kick of spice that complements the sweetness of the mangoes.
  5. Chill: Cover the salad and chill it in the refrigerator for 15-20 minutes to allow the flavors to meld beautifully before serving.

Notes

  • Use ripe, juicy mangoes for the best sweet and tangy flavor.
  • The salad can be customized by adding proteins such as grilled shrimp or chicken for a heartier meal.
  • Adding roasted peanuts or cashews can enhance texture with extra crunch.
  • Serve over mixed greens or quinoa for a more filling main dish option.
  • This salad is best served chilled to enhance its refreshing qualities.
